6.1 Clinical Trials Experience Because clinical trials are conducted under widely varying conditions, adverse reaction rates observed in the clinical trials of a drug cannot be directly compared to rates in the clinical trials of another drug and may not reflect the rates observed in practice.
A total of 618 patients were treated with XTORO in two Phase 3 clinical trials.
The most frequently reported adverse reactions of those exposed to XTORO occurring at an incidence of 1% included ear pruritus and nausea.
5 WARNINGS AND PRECAUTIONS Prolonged use of this product may lead to overgrowth of nonsusceptible organisms.
Discontinue use if this occurs.
( 5.1 ) Allergic reactions may occur in patients with a history of hypersensitivity to finafloxacin, to other quinolones, or to any of the components in this medication.
Discontinue use if this occurs.
( 5.2 ) 5.1 Growth of Resistant Organisms with Prolonged Use As with other antibacterial preparations, prolonged use of XTORO may lead to overgrowth of nonsusceptible organisms, including yeast and fungi.
